Green Bay, Wisconsin vs Herat Climate & Distance Between

Afghanistan flag
  • The distance between Green Bay, Wisconsin, Usa and Herat, Afghanistan is approximately 10,763 km or 6,688 mi.
  • To reach Green Bay, Wisconsin in this distance one would set out from Herat bearing 339.2°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Green Bay, Wisconsin bearing 204.3° or SSW .
  • Green Bay, Wisconsin has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Herat has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
  • Green Bay, Wisconsin is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Herat is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 9.3 °C (16.7°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.8 °C (6.8°F) more in Green Bay, Wisconsin.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 493.4 mm (19.4 in) more which is equivalent to 493.4 l/m² (12.11 US gal/ft²) or 4,934,000 l/ha (527,477 US gal/ac) more. About 3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.3° lower in Green Bay, Wisconsin than in Herat.
  • Relative humidity levels are 12.1% higher.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 5°C (9°F) lower.
